July 16, 1975: What was the moon phase on that day?


Moon phase

65%

The moon phase on July 16, 1975 was First Quarter.

The moon phase refers to the appearance of the Moon in the night sky on July 16, 1975 and is determined by the portion of the Moon's illuminated surface that is visible from Earth.

An observer located in New York City on July 16, 1975 at 10pm, would see the moon, being 65% full, rising at 02:26 pm and setting at 12:52 am.

The previous full moon was on Jun 23, 1975 while the next full moon would come on Jul 23, 1975.

Who was the US President on July 16, 1975?

On July 16, 1975 the US President was Gerald Ford (Republican).

Who was the UK Prime Minister on July 16, 1975?

On July 16, 1975 the UK Prime Minister was Harold Wilson (Labour).

Who was the Pope on July 16, 1975?

On July 16, 1975 the Pope was St Paul VI.
